Football Community Mourns Young Player Fionn Dooley Who Died Before 16th Birthday
The football community across Dublin and beyond is coming together to pay tribute to a young player who tragically passed away just before reaching his 16th birthday. Fionn Dooley, a dedicated footballer with Knocklyon United, died peacefully at his home in Rathfarnham on Friday, January 30th, leaving his family, friends, and teammates devastated.
Club Pays Heartfelt Tribute to Brave Centre Back
Knocklyon United Football Club shared the heartbreaking news with their community, describing Fionn as "a fighter who battled with great courage and dignity." The club's official statement expressed their deepest condolences to Fionn's family, including his parents Linda and Chris, brothers Oisín and Callum, and sister Leah.
Kenny Soper, Fionn's manager at the club, remembered the young player as "an outstanding centre back and a real team player" who always stood up for his teammates. Soper emphasized Fionn's passion for football and how deeply he will be missed by everyone who knew him through the sport.
Football Community Unites in Grief
In a powerful show of solidarity and respect, a minute's silence was observed at all Knocklyon United matches over the weekend following Fionn's passing. The tribute extended beyond his own club, with several other football organisations reaching out with messages of support and condolence.
Newlands Castle Park FC expressed their sincere condolences to Fionn's family, friends, and everyone at Knocklyon United, while St Francis FC also shared their thoughts and prayers with all those affected by the young footballer's passing.
Remembering Fionn's Life and Legacy
According to family tributes, Fionn brought "so much fun and laughter" to his friends' lives, and his cherished memories will remain in their hearts forever. The death notice described him as someone who fought his health battle with remarkable courage until the end.
Fionn's funeral arrangements have been announced, with his body lying in repose at Peter Massey Funerals at The Ruah Centre in Ballyroan. A funeral Mass will be held at the Church of the Holy Spirit in Ballyroan, followed by cremation at Mount Jerome Crematorium.
In a touching gesture reflecting Fionn's spirit, the family has requested that instead of flowers, donations be made to Oscar's Kids Ireland in his memory. This charitable choice underscores the community-minded values that Fionn embodied throughout his too-short life.
